Fibe Plans ₹750 Crore Raise to Expand Digital Lending

Fibe is a company that gives loans using digital technology.

It plans to raise ₹750 crore for its lending business and other company needs.

The company also wants to improve its technology and artificial intelligence systems.

These tools help Fibe assess borrowers and manage loans.

Fibe’s total loans under management grew to ₹8,603 crore by March 2026.

Its annual profit increased to ₹257 crore in FY26.

During that year, the platform handled about 1.31 million loan applications each month.

Fibe used information such as income, employment and credit history to decide which applicants could receive loans.

Key facts

Planned raise
₹750 crore
Assets under management
₹8,603 crore as of March 2026, up from ₹4,064 crore as of March 31, 2024
AUM growth
45% compounded annual growth rate
FY26 profit
₹257 crore, compared with ₹114 crore in FY25
Monthly applications
About 1.31 million loan applications processed during FY26
FY26 disbursals
₹7,614 crore in fresh loan disbursals
Unique applicants
15.74 million during FY26, including 2.02 million approved through Fibe’s credit assessment process
